Crusaders Head Into Break With Loss

SPRUCE GROVE, AB – When it comes to the play between the first two games and the one played Wednesday night, the Sherwood Park Crusaders certainly have closed the gap between themselves and their crosstown rivals the Spruce Grove Saints. 

Crusader Goaltender Brandon Vogel made a season high 49 saves but it wasn't enough as the Crusaders fell 4-2 to the Spruce Grove Saints Wednesday night, snapping the teams four game winning streak.

After weathering the storm through the first five minutes, it was evident the game could be a close one.  Spruce Grove would open the scoring on a nifty passing sequence between Jordan Biro and Austin Parmiter, 13:55 into the first period.

The Crusaders would respond 27 seconds later as rookie Forward Garrett Clegg netted his 13th goal of the season, over the blocker of Saint Goaltender Hayden Missler.

The first period finished tied at one.

Sherwood Park would get their only lead of the hockey game 7:58 into the second on a power play goal from Arjun Atwal. 

The lead would last just over eight minutes as the Saints were able to square things up at two as Parker Saretsky buried a feed at the top of the Crusader crease from Jordan Biro on the left wing side.

Things would remain tied at two after the second period.

The Crusaders couldn't muster up a whole lot in the third period with only four shots on goal and the Saints were able to capitalize on their time in the offensive zone.  Goals coming less than two minutes apart at 15:31 thanks to Jamieson Ree and Sean Comrie would give the Saints a 4-2 win and their third of the season over the Crusaders.

Sherwood Park will enjoy a week off for their holiday break and resume play next Friday in Fort McMurray for the first of two games against the MOB on the road.
